Transaction d08ce6914d610459b33326bf6848733a257b6ac351b73d0e961e3e333e30dac7

126 Input
2 Outputs
  • d08ce6914d610459b33326bf6848733a257b6ac351b73d0e961e3e333e30dac7:0
  • value  134440
    address  34hnUZsDQPnnfwE9GN7Udqc2Dq9HcZdkpG
  • d08ce6914d610459b33326bf6848733a257b6ac351b73d0e961e3e333e30dac7:1
  • value  4630733786
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s